Posttranslational Modification | Comment | Organism |
---|---|---|
glycoprotein | contains about 35% N-linked oligosaccharides, treatment of enzyme with peptide N-glycosidase F causes a marked decrease in activity, production of active form of recombinant enzyme is inhibited by tunicamycin | Rattus norvegicus |
